Full-time BVS Students 

Broward Virtual School offers a full-time enrollment option for students in grades 6-12.  Full-time BVS students are registered as public school students, take part in FCAT and other district testing, and have the opportunity to earn a standard Broward County diploma. 

In order to be accepted as a full-time student with Broward Virtual School for the 2010-11 school year, you must:

1) have demonstrated success in the previous semester courses (grades of C or better).

2) have attained a minimum score on at least one of the following standardized tests in the 2009-10 school year:

  1. FCAT Sunshine State Standards (level 2 or higher on the reading section)
  2. Stanford Achievement Test (50th percentile or higher on the reading section)
  3. Iowa Test of Basic Skills (50th percentile or higher on the reading section)
  4. grade level proficiency on an official standardized test administered by another public school system

3) reside in Broward County

Students who meet the requirements listed above must submit the online prospective full-time student application. 


Home School Students

In addition to our full-time program, Broward Virtual School offers middle and high school courses to home school students. Home school students have two options at Broward Virtual School. Students may:

      1. Retain home school status and utilize free online courses for their curriculum or

      2. Apply for enrollment in our full-time, diploma granting program (subject to entrance criteria above)

It is important to know that Broward Virtual offers high school diplomas to students registered in our full-time program only.

Broward Virtual School is not responsible for promoting home school students to the next grade level.  Home School students are required to turn in their yearly evaluation by a certified teacher to the Home School Department. In order to be accepted as a home school student with Broward Virtual School you must register with the Broward County Home Education Department .

Registration for home school students is ongoing

Private School Part-Time BVS Students

Private school part-time students are enrolled in a private Broward County middle or high school full-time and take supplemental courses online with Broward Virtual.  In order to be accepted as a part-time, private school student with Broward Virtual School you must reside in Broward County and attend a Broward County private school.

Parent and student must inform the school guidance counselor of completed registration.  The school guidance counselor will verify the information online, ensure that the course requested is appropriate for the student, and electronically approve requested courses.

All students must have daily access to a computer with dependable high speed Internet access and a printer.

Activation for private school part-time students will begin in August 2009.

Public School Part-Time BVS Students

Public school part-time students are enrolled in a traditional Broward County middle or high school full-time and may take supplemental courses online with Broward Virtual.  Part-time students take courses online for graduation acceleration, credit recovery, grade forgiveness, or to earn high school credit while in middle school.  In order to be accepted as a part-time, public school student with Broward Virtual School you must currently attend a Broward County public school.

Parent and student must inform the school guidance counselor of completed registration.  School guidance counselor will verify information online, ensure that the course requested is appropriate for the student, and electronically approve requested courses.

Activation for public school part-time students will begin in August 2009 pending guidance counselor approval.
